Dr. Kelley Whitaker

Natural Beekeeper | Apitherapy Advocate | Founder of Castlecrag Honey

Kelley Whitaker is a former marine evolutionary biologist with a specialist background in population genetics. Her path took an unexpected and profound turn when a swarm of bees landed at her neighbour’s entranceway an encounter that catalysed her journey into bee stewardship.

With a deep respect for nature’s intelligence, Kelley is committed to supporting bees in living out their biological and evolutionary lives with as little human interference as possible. Her beekeeping approach is grounded in non-invasive, bee-centric methods that prioritise the health and autonomy of the hive.

Kelley is also a passionate advocate for Apitherapy, the medicinal use of bee products, and co-founded the Australian Apitherapy Association, where she served as both Secretary and Treasurer. Her work in this field reflects her belief in the powerful intersection of science, wellness, and the wisdom of the hive.

Since founding Castlecrag Honey Pty Ltd in 2015, Kelley has worked as a commercial, non-migratory beekeeper, offering honey that is local, ethical, and aligned with the natural rhythms of the bees.
